Talwar village is located in the Baldwara Tehsil of the Mandi district in Himachal Pradesh .
Block / Tehsil → Baldwara
District → Mandi
State → Himachal Pradesh
According to Census 2011 information, the village code of Talwar village is 175033.
Talwar village has a total population of 147 people, of which 70 are males and 77 are females.
The literacy rate of Talwar village is 79.59%. Male literacy stands at 82.86% and female literacy at 76.62%.
There are approximately 35 households in Talwar village.
Rawalsar is the nearest town to Talwar village for major economic activities
